Intel Core i9-13900K

The Intel Core i9-13900K is the crème de la crème of 13th gen Intel CPUs, offering unparalleled performance and power. With 24 cores and 32 threads, this beast of a processor can handle even the most demanding tasks with ease. Whether it’s 4K video editing, 3D modeling, or extreme gaming, the i9-13900K has the chops to deliver seamless and lightning-fast performance. Its impressive specs include a 3.0 GHz base clock speed, 5.8 GHz boost clock speed, and 36 MB of cache memory.

What really sets the i9-13900K apart, however, is its exceptional overclocking capabilities. Enthusiasts will love the ability to push this processor to its limits, unlocking even more performance and flexibility. Of course, all this power comes at a price – literally. The i9-13900K is one of the most expensive CPUs on the market, and its power consumption is equally impressive. But for those who need the absolute best, this processor is the ultimate choice. With its unparalleled performance, impressive specs, and overclocking capabilities, the Intel Core i9-13900K is the top dog in the 13th gen Intel CPU lineup.

Intel Core i7-13700K

The Intel Core i7-13700K is another powerhouse of a processor, offering a perfect balance of performance and affordability. With 16 cores and 24 threads, this CPU is more than capable of handling demanding tasks like gaming, video editing, and content creation. Its impressive specs include a 3.4 GHz base clock speed, 5.4 GHz boost clock speed, and 30 MB of cache memory. Whether it’s streaming, rendering, or just plain old gaming, the i7-13700K has the muscle to deliver smooth and seamless performance.

One of the standout features of the i7-13700K is its exceptional gaming performance. With its high clock speeds and ample cores, this processor can handle even the most demanding games at high frame rates and resolutions. Additionally, its PCIe 5.0 support and DDR5 memory compatibility make it future-proof and ready for the latest hardware. While it may not have the same level of overclocking headroom as the i9-13900K, the i7-13700K is still an excellent choice for enthusiasts and gamers who need a powerful and reliable processor.

Intel Core i5-13600K

The Intel Core i5-13600K is a fantastic mid-range option for those who want a powerful processor without breaking the bank. With 14 cores and 20 threads, this CPU offers a great balance of performance and affordability. Its specs include a 3.5 GHz base clock speed, 5.1 GHz boost clock speed, and 24.75 MB of cache memory. Whether it’s gaming, streaming, or just general productivity, the i5-13600K has the chops to deliver smooth and seamless performance.

What really sets the i5-13600K apart, however, is its exceptional value proposition. Priced significantly lower than the i7 and i9 variants, this processor offers a lot of bang for the buck. Its performance is still more than capable of handling demanding tasks, and its power consumption is relatively low. Additionally, its overclocking capabilities are still respectable, making it a great choice for enthusiasts who want to squeeze out every last bit of performance. Overall, the Intel Core i5-13600K is an excellent mid-range option for those who need a powerful and reliable processor without the hefty price tag.

Clock Speed

Another important factor to consider when buying a 13th Gen Intel CPU is the clock speed. The clock speed, measured in GHz, determines how fast the CPU can execute instructions. A higher clock speed means the CPU can handle more tasks per second, making it ideal for applications that require fast processing times. For example, if you’re a gamer who wants to play the latest games at high frame rates, a CPU with a high clock speed will be able to deliver smooth and responsive performance.

But clock speed isn’t the only factor to consider. It’s also important to consider the type of clock speed. For example, some CPUs have a base clock speed and a boost clock speed. The base clock speed is the default speed of the CPU, while the boost clock speed is the maximum speed the CPU can reach when needed. Some CPUs also have a feature called Turbo Boost, which allows the CPU to temporarily increase its clock speed when needed. When considering clock speed, be sure to look at the base clock speed, boost clock speed, and Turbo Boost features to get a complete picture of the CPU’s performance.

Are 13th Gen Intel CPUs compatible with older motherboards?

The compatibility of 13th Gen Intel CPUs with older motherboards depends on the specific motherboard and chipset. In general, 13th Gen Intel CPUs use the LGA 1700 socket, which is the same socket used by 12th Gen Intel CPUs. This means that some older motherboards may be compatible with 13th Gen Intel CPUs, but it’s not a guarantee. You’ll need to check the motherboard manufacturer’s website to see if your specific motherboard is compatible with 13th Gen Intel CPUs.

If your motherboard is not compatible with 13th Gen Intel CPUs, you may need to upgrade to a new motherboard or consider purchasing a different CPU. However, many motherboard manufacturers are offering BIOS updates that allow their motherboards to support 13th Gen Intel CPUs. It’s worth noting that even if your motherboard is compatible with 13th Gen Intel CPUs, you may still need to update the BIOS to take full advantage of the CPU’s features and performance. Be sure to check the motherboard manufacturer’s website for compatibility and BIOS update information before making a purchase.
